Draw them into an L-shaped ambush and open fire, its time for another edition of EpicBattleCry! In this week’s skirmish we check the just-announced Mech Warrior game, laugh ourselves silly over Singularity being delayed to make way for Modern Warfare 2, discuss the news of a fourth and final installment for Command & Conquer, and check out the DLC that enhances (some would say fixes) the control scheme for Fight Night Round 4.

The, Eidos goes under the axe, as we examine the recent reports that they once again trying to fix review scores for the upcoming Batman: Arkham Asylum, which leads to an even deeper discussion on game scores and whether or not they’re still relevant. Next, we open a galactic can of worms by evaluating the state of the Halo franchise and pondering whether it deserves its considerable accolades.

The Battle Cry of the Week, goes to Japan’s recently unveiled life-size Gundam model, Battlefield 1943, the ridiculous new Wii title Walk it Out, and reminisces about the good ‘ol days when buying a game meant that you received all the content for that game.

Activision have announced their plans to move Singularity to Q1 2010. The reason? Well Singularity was suppose to be released this fall (along with every other game in existence), but Activision is worried that Modern Warfare 2 will cut sales on Singularity this holiday season.

Kotaku has Activision’s explaination:

“The level of excitement for Infinity Ward’s Modern Warfare 2 coming out of E3 well exceeded our expectations and therefore we have decided to move Raven’s upcoming sci-fi first person action title, Singularity, from 2009 to Q1 2010,” said an Activision spokesperson. “We believe that the March quarter will provide a better opportunity to establish the new cutting-edge action IP as a ‘must-have’ title and clears the way for Modern Warfare 2 to dominate this holiday season.”

Although it’s lame that we won’t be able to play Singularity until early next year. They do have a valid reason why to move the date for this new title. Releasing Singularity in fall will only have the game lost in the sea of titles washing up this fall. Releasing it in Q1 of next year, will give the title a chance to find land.
